Andrew Bogott has uploaded a new change for review. ( 
https://gerrit.wikimedia.org/r/368097 )

Change subject: labtestpuppetmaster:  add lots of hiera defs
......................................................................

labtestpuppetmaster:  add lots of hiera defs

Change-Id: I50d583acfc2f5c8b0c36c35d9c31818d89481ff7
---
M hieradata/role/common/labs/puppetmaster/backend.yaml
M hieradata/role/common/labs/puppetmaster/frontend.yaml
2 files changed, 40 insertions(+), 2 deletions(-)


  git pull ssh://gerrit.wikimedia.org:29418/operations/puppet 
refs/changes/97/368097/1

diff --git a/hieradata/role/common/labs/puppetmaster/backend.yaml 
b/hieradata/role/common/labs/puppetmaster/backend.yaml
index cbb7833..22b6980 100644
--- a/hieradata/role/common/labs/puppetmaster/backend.yaml
+++ b/hieradata/role/common/labs/puppetmaster/backend.yaml
@@ -6,3 +6,24 @@
   autosign: true
 
 profile::puppetmaster::backend::secure_private: false
+
+profile::conftool::master::sync_dir: "/etc/conftool/data"
+
+profile::puppetmaster::frontend::web_hostname: labs-puppetmaster.wikimedia.org
+profile::puppetmaster::common::storeconfigs: none
+
+profile::puppetmaster::labsencapi::mysql_host: m5-master
+profile::puppetmaster::labsencapi::mysql_db:   labspuppet
+profile::puppetmaster::labsencapi::mysql_username: labspuppet
+profile::puppetmaster::labsencapi::statsd_host: labmon1001.eqiad.wmnet
+profile::puppetmaster::labsencapi::statsd_prefix: labs.puppetbackend
+
+puppetmaster::servers:
+  labpuppetmaster1001.wikimedia.org:
+    - { worker: labpuppetmaster1001.wikimedia.org, loadfactor: 10 }
+    - { worker: labpuppetmaster1002.wikimedia.org, loadfactor: 20 }
+puppetmaster::ca_server: labs-puppetmaster.wikimedia.org
+
+labs_puppet_master: labs-puppetmaster.wikimedia.org
+
+puppetmaster::hiera_config: labs
diff --git a/hieradata/role/common/labs/puppetmaster/frontend.yaml 
b/hieradata/role/common/labs/puppetmaster/frontend.yaml
index dc9e9fd..22b6980 100644
--- a/hieradata/role/common/labs/puppetmaster/frontend.yaml
+++ b/hieradata/role/common/labs/puppetmaster/frontend.yaml
@@ -8,5 +8,22 @@
 profile::puppetmaster::backend::secure_private: false
 
 profile::conftool::master::sync_dir: "/etc/conftool/data"
-profile::discovery::path: "/srv/config-master/discovery"
-profile::discovery::watch_interval: 60
+
+profile::puppetmaster::frontend::web_hostname: labs-puppetmaster.wikimedia.org
+profile::puppetmaster::common::storeconfigs: none
+
+profile::puppetmaster::labsencapi::mysql_host: m5-master
+profile::puppetmaster::labsencapi::mysql_db:   labspuppet
+profile::puppetmaster::labsencapi::mysql_username: labspuppet
+profile::puppetmaster::labsencapi::statsd_host: labmon1001.eqiad.wmnet
+profile::puppetmaster::labsencapi::statsd_prefix: labs.puppetbackend
+
+puppetmaster::servers:
+  labpuppetmaster1001.wikimedia.org:
+    - { worker: labpuppetmaster1001.wikimedia.org, loadfactor: 10 }
+    - { worker: labpuppetmaster1002.wikimedia.org, loadfactor: 20 }
+puppetmaster::ca_server: labs-puppetmaster.wikimedia.org
+
+labs_puppet_master: labs-puppetmaster.wikimedia.org
+
+puppetmaster::hiera_config: labs

-- 
To view, visit https://gerrit.wikimedia.org/r/368097
To unsubscribe, visit https://gerrit.wikimedia.org/r/settings

Gerrit-MessageType: newchange
Gerrit-Change-Id: I50d583acfc2f5c8b0c36c35d9c31818d89481ff7
Gerrit-PatchSet: 1
Gerrit-Project: operations/puppet
Gerrit-Branch: production
Gerrit-Owner: Andrew Bogott <abog...@wikimedia.org>

_______________________________________________
MediaWiki-commits mailing list
MediaWiki-commits@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its

Reply via email to